/* CSS Document */

body{
	/*background:#053E51;*/
	background:#003;
	margin:0;
	font-family: Tahoma;
	font-size: 12px;
}

a:link, a:visited {
color:#FF9900;
font-weight:bold;
font-family:Arial, Helvetica, sans-serif;
font-size:12px;
text-decoration: none
}
a:hover {
	color:#00FFFF;
}
.f1 {font:Narkisim; color:#39ECF3; font-size:14px; }
.f4 {font:Narkisim; color:#39ECF3; font-size:18px; }

#wrapper {
	width:1024px;
	margin: 0 auto;
	background: #053E51;
}
#content{
	margin:3px;
	/*background:#006;
	padding-right:3px;*/
}
#f2 {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	color:#33FFFF;
	font-size:12px;
}

#f3 {
	font:Kalinga;
	color:#FFFFFF;
	
}


#banner {
	width: 1024px;
	height: 214px;
	margin: 0 auto;
	background:url(images/banner.jpg);
	
	
}

#menu_atas {
	font:Constantia;
	color:#FF6600;
	font-size:14px;
	border-left: 2px;
	float:left;
	padding-right:10px;
	margin-top:10px;
	
}

#button  {
	width: 143px;
	height: 58px;
	float: left;
	background: url(images/button2.jpg);
	text-align:center;
	font-size:12px;
	text-decoration:none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
}





	
#page {
	width: 1024px;
	margin: 0 auto;
	padding: 0px;
	background-color:#1E667C;
}

/*#content {
	float:right;
	width: 750px;
	background-color:#1E667C;
}*/



#side {
	margin-left:11px;
	float:left;
	width: 220px;
	background-color:#1E667C;
}

#tablePerkhidmatan {
	font:Narkisim;
	font-size:16px;
	color:#00FFFF;
	background:#006;
}

#space {
	float:right;
	width: 25px;
	
	background-color:#1E667C;
}



.post {
	margin-bottom: 25px;
}

.post .title {
	height: 30px;
	margin-bottom: 3px;
	font:Verdana, Arial, Helvetica, sans-serif;
	font-size:16px;
		color: #FFFFFF;
}

#footer {
	font:"Courier New", Courier, monospace;
	font-size:14px;
	
	}

.frm{
	padding-right:10px;
	font-weight:bold;
}

.headfront{
	background:#4A2020;
	font-weight:bold;
	color:#FFF;
	font-size:12px;
	padding:5px;
}

.bottomfront{
	background:#E7EBEF;
	font-size:11px;
	padding:5px;
	height:400px;
	overflow:scroll;
}

.generic2{
	border: 1px solid #cccccc;
  	background-color:#D8FEF0;
	
}

.generic{
	border: 1px solid #cccccc;
  	background-color:#DFF1FF;
	
}

.generic td{
	padding-left: 3px;
  	padding-top: 4px;
  	padding-bottom:3px;
	font-size:10px;
}

table.contentview {
  border: 1px solid #cccccc;
  padding: 2px;
  margin-left: 2px;
  margin-bottom: 2px;
  
  font-family:Arial, Helvetica, sans-serif;
  font-size:12px;
}

table.contentview td {
  padding: 3px;
  /*border:1px #95FDDE solid;*/
  height:35px;
  background:#FDFBC8;
  /*#F5F5F5*/
}


table.contentview th {
  	background: url(../images/subhead_bg.gif) repeat-x;
  	color: #ffffff;
	text-align: left;
	/*padding-top: 2px;
	padding-left: 4px;
	height: 21px;*/
	font-weight: bold;
	font-size: 11px;
	text-transform: uppercase;
}

/*------------------Contenttoc-----------------------*/


/*----------------contenttoc class -----------------*/

table.contenttoc {
  border: 1px solid #cccccc;
  padding: 2px;
  margin-left: 2px;
  margin-bottom: 2px;
  background-color:#F5F5F5;
}

table.contenttoc td {
  padding: 3px;
  /**/
}

table.contenttoc th {
  	background: url(../images/subhead_bg.gif) repeat-x;
  	color: #ffffff;
	text-align: left;
	/*padding-top: 2px;
	padding-left: 4px;
	height: 21px;*/
	font-weight: bold;
	font-size: 11px;
	text-transform: uppercase;
}
table.contenttoc2 {
  border: 1px solid #cccccc;
  padding: 2px;
  margin-left: 2px;
  margin-bottom: 2px;
}

table.contenttoc2 td {
  padding: 2px;
  font-size: 9px;
  background-color:#F5F5F5;
}

table.contenttoc2 th {
  	background: url(../images/subhead_bg.gif) repeat-x;
  	color: #ffffff;
	text-align: left;
	/*padding-top: 2px;
	padding-left: 4px;
	height: 21px;*/
	font-weight: bold;
	font-size: 8px;
	text-transform: uppercase;
}
table.contenttoc2 a:link, table.contenttoc2 a:visited {
	color: #ff6600; text-decoration: none;
	font-size: 9px;
	font-weight: bold;
}

table.contenttoc2 a:hover {
	color: #C43C03;	text-decoration: none;
	font-size: 9px;
	font-weight: bold;
}

table.contenttoc3 {
  border-left: 1px solid #cccccc;
  border-top: 1px solid #cccccc;
  border-right: 2px solid buttonshadow;
  border-bottom: 2px solid buttonshadow;
  padding: 2px;
  margin-top: 10px;
  /*margin-left: 20px;*/
  margin-bottom: 2px;
}

table.contenttoc3 td {
  padding-left: 5px;
  font-size: 12px;
  height:25px;
  border:solid 1px #948EF9;
  background-color:buttonface;
}

table.contenttoc3 th {
  	background: url(../images/subhead_bg.gif) repeat-x;
  	color: #ffffff;
	text-align: left;
	/*padding-top: 2px;
	padding-left: 4px;
	height: 21px;*/
	font-weight: bold;
	font-size: 8px;
	text-transform: uppercase;
}
table.contentport {
  border-left: 1px solid #cccccc;
  border-top: 1px solid #cccccc;
  border-right: 2px solid buttonshadow;
  border-bottom: 2px solid buttonshadow;
  padding: 2px;
  margin-top: 10px;
  /*margin-left: 20px; width:95%;*/
  margin-bottom: 2px;
 
}

table.contentport td {
  padding-left: 5px;
  font-size: 12px;
  height:25px;
  border:solid 1px #CCCCCC;
  background-color:buttonface;
}

table.contentport th {
  	background: url(../images/subhead_bg.gif) repeat-x;
  	color: #ffffff;
	text-align: left;
	/*padding-top: 2px;
	padding-left: 4px;
	height: 21px;*/
	font-weight: bold;
	font-size: 11px;
	text-transform: uppercase;
}



/*----------------------------------------------------*/
.csry{
color:#FF0000;
font-weight:bold;
}	

/*table {
	width:190px;	
}*/

table.moduletable {
	width:190px;	
}

table.moduletable th{
	background-image:url(../images/h.jpg);
	font-family:Arial, Helvetica, sans-serif;
	color: #FFFFFF;
	background-color:#FFFFFF;
	height:25px;
	/*border: 1px #33FFFF solid;
	border-collapse: collapse;
	border-spacing: 0px;*/
}


table.moduletable td{
	background-color: #24AFC2;
	padding-left:10px;
	padding-right:2px;
	height:15px;
	font-family:Arial, Helvetica, sans-serif;
	font-weight: bold;
	color:#FFFFFF;
	font-size: 12px;	
}

table.moduletable td #smalltext{
	font-size:10px;
	
}

th.moduletable2 {
	font-family:Kalinga;
	font-size:15px;
	color: #FFFFCC;
	background-color:#9FC20E;
	padding-left:15px;
	-moz-border-radius: 6px ;
}



td.moduletable2 {
	padding: 3px;
	font-family: Cambria;
	color: #006633;
	background-color:#F1F7B9;
	padding-right:10px;
	padding-left:8px;
}

table3 {
	border:3px;
	border-color:#FF3366;
	border-bottom:thin;
}


th.table3 {
	text-align:center;
	font-family:Cambria;
	background-image:url(image/3.jpg);
	-moz-border-radius: 6px 6px 6px 6px;
	border-color: rgb(237, 105, 128) rgb(237, 105, 128) rgb(237, 105, 128) rgb(237, 105, 128);
	border-width: 2px 2px 2px 2px;
	padding: 3px 3px 3px 3px;
	color:#FFFFFF;
}

td.table3 {
	
	padding: 3px;
	background-color: rgb(250, 240, 230);
	font-family:Narkisim;
	color:#FF6699;
	padding-right:3px;
	
}
img{
	border:none;
}

/*header_text*/
.header_text { margin:0 auto 10px auto; padding:5px 10px; width:940px; border-bottom:1px solid #d8d8d8; }
.header_text h2 { font: normal 14px Arial, Helvetica, sans-serif; color:#6d6d6d; padding:5px 0; margin:0; }
.header_text h2 span { font: normal 11px Arial, Helvetica, sans-serif; color:#a2a2a2; }
.header_text img { float:right; margin:0; padding:5px 0 0 0; }
/*FBG_blog*/
.FBG_blog { background:#171717; border-top:1px solid #fff; margin:0; padding:0; }
.FBG_blog_resize { width:940px; margin:0 auto; padding:0; }
.FBG_blog_resize h2 { font: normal 18px Arial, Helvetica, sans-serif; color:#fff; padding:0; margin:0; }
.FBG_blog_resize p { font: normal 11px Arial, Helvetica, sans-serif; color:#7e7e7e; padding:0; margin:0; }
.FBG_blog_resize img { float:right; margin:0; padding:0; }
.FBG_blog_resize .recent { width:320px; float:left; padding:0; margin:20px 0 0 0; border-right:2px solid #616161; }
.FBG_blog_resize .recent2 { width:430px; text-align:center; float:left; padding:5px 0 2px 0; margin:20px 0 0 0; border-right:1px solid #616161; }
/*FBG*/
.FBG { background:#1b1b1b; border-top:1px solid #272727; margin:0; padding:0;height:180px; }
.FBG_resize { width:1024px; margin:0 auto; padding:20px 0; }
.FBG_resize p { font: normal 11px Arial, Helvetica, sans-serif; color:#717171; padding:5px; margin:0; line-height:1.8em; }
.FBG_resize ul { list-style:none; margin:10px auto; padding:0; }
.FBG_resize li { padding:0; margin:0; }
.FBG_resize li a { font: normal 11px Arial, Helvetica, sans-serif; color:#666666; text-decoration:none; }
.FBG_resize li a:hover { color:#d5d5d5; }
.FBG_resize h2 { font: bold 14px Arial, Helvetica, sans-serif; color:#d5d5d5; padding:5px; margin:0; }
.FBG_resize .left { width:120px; float:left; margin:10px 10px 10px 20px; padding:10px 5px; }
/* END_bloga*/
/*************footer**********/
.footer { padding:0; margin:0; background:#1b1b1b; }
.footer_resize { width:940px; margin:0 auto; padding:0px 10px; border-top:1px solid #2b2b2b; }
.footer p { font:normal 11px Arial, Helvetica, sans-serif; color:#a2a2a2; }
.footer a { font:bold 11px Arial, Helvetica, sans-serif; color:#a2a2a2; text-decoration:none; padding:5px; margin:0; }
.footer p.right { text-align:right; width:350px; margin:0; padding:15px 0 0 0; float:right; }
.footer p.leftt { text-align:left; width:550px; margin:0; padding:15px 0 0 0; float:left; }

#login-box {
	width:333px;
	height: 352px;
	padding: 58px 76px 0 76px;
	color: #ebebeb;
	font: 12px Arial, Helvetica, sans-serif;
	background:url(../images/login-box-backg.png) top left no-repeat;
}

#login-box img {
	border:none;
}

#login-box h2 {
	padding:0;
	margin:0;
	color: #ebebeb;
	font: bold 44px "Calibri", Arial;
}


#login-box-name {
	float: left;
	display:inline;
	width:80px;
	text-align: right;
	padding: 14px 10px 0 0;
	margin:0 0 7px 0;
}

#login-box-field {
	float: left;
	display:inline;
	width:230px;
	margin:0;
	margin:0 0 7px 0;
}


.form-login  {
	width: 205px;
	padding: 10px 4px 6px 3px;
	border: 1px solid #0d2c52;
	background-color:#1e4f8a;
	font-size: 16px;
	color: #ebebeb;
}


.login-box-options  {
	clear:both;
	padding-left:87px;
	font-size: 11px;
}

.login-box-options a {
	color: #ebebeb;
	font-size: 11px;
}
.barrier{
	opacity:0.65;
	-moz-opacity:0.65;
	filter:alpha(opacity=65);
	position:absolute; 
	background:#333333; 
	display:none; 
	height:0px;
	width:0px;
	left:0px;
	top:0px
}

/* begin: jQuery UI Datepicker moving pixels fix */
table.ui-datepicker-calendar {border-collapse: separate;}
.ui-datepicker-calendar td {border: 1px solid transparent;}
/* end: jQuery UI Datepicker moving pixels fix */

/* begin: jQuery UI Datepicker emphasis on selected dates */
.hasDatepicker .ui-datepicker .ui-datepicker-calendar .ui-state-highlight a {
	background: #743620 none;
	color: white;
}
/* end: jQuery UI Datepicker emphasis on selected dates */

/* begin: jQuery UI Datepicker hide datepicker helper */
#ui-datepicker-div {display:none;}
/* end: jQuery UI Datepicker hide datepicker helper */
